                Not with the program, but to say that Amity has no soccer tradition reflects you don't know much about their girls soccer program. Was in the doldrums till Quigley showed up in the 1990s, back in the old Houstatonic League (Shelton, Cheshire, Sheehan, Lyman Hall, North Haven were also all in that league). They became a dominant program shortly after and along with Cheshire and Guilford, pretty much ran the girls soccer situation in the early days of the SCC. They are a fine program and win year in and year out.
